Is Wellington Parc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Wellington Parc in Lake Worth, FL has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 35, which is 65%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Lake Worth average (crime index 115), Wellington Parc is 80%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Lake Worth as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.

Looking at specific crime types, robbery is the most elevated concern (index: 61, 39% below average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 20).
